Encrypt all data on your Samsung Galaxy Note 9 using encryption

Last option, and, you will understand, the one that ensures maximum security is encrypt your Samsung Galaxy Note 9 using a data encryption system , you will then have all the data on your smartphone which can be encrypted, this intervention requires time, depending on the volume of data stored on your Samsung Galaxy Note 9 it may take more than an hour. We therefore recommend this option for people for whom the security of their data is essential. To encrypt them, we suggest you use the application SSE , who will be able to accompany you and take charge of the entire procedure:

  • Download and install the application on your Samsung Galaxy Note 9
  • Open SSE
  • Press "File / Dir Encryptor"
  • Select the folder or file you want to encrypt
  • Choose a password and confirm the procedure
  • You will now be able to access it only through the application and the functionality "Decrypt Fil" or Decrypt Dir "
